Kaali Maa, one of the most powerful and revered forms of Goddess Shakti, holds a significant place in Hindu mythology and spiritual tradition. The history of Kaali Maa marble statues is deeply connected to ancient Indian religious practices, temple architecture, and the evolution of sacred sculpture. From early stone carvings to finely polished marble murtis, the journey of Kaali Maa statues reflects centuries of devotion, art, and cultural heritage.
The origin of Kaali Maa worship dates back to the Vedic and Puranic periods, where she is described as the fierce yet protective form of the Divine Mother. Early representations of Kaali Maa were carved in stone and terracotta, mainly in temple walls and sacred sites. These early statues emphasized her powerful stance, dark complexion, protruding tongue, garland of skulls, and weapons, symbolizing the destruction of evil and the protection of dharma. As temple construction flourished across India, especially during the Gupta, Pala, and later medieval periods, idol-making became more refined and symbolic.
